RF Engineering Technician
BAE Systems is looking for an experienced Digital/RF Technician to join their fast-paced Engineering and Test team in Nashua, New Hampshire. You will be supporting a wide variety of tasks in the day-to-day operation within an engineering lab.
Defense & Space
Responsibilities
Work from drawings, diagrams, customer specifications, schematics and/or test procedures
Diagnose and analyze problems utilizing a variety of test equipment
Utilize methodical and logical reasoning processes to resolve complex technical issues
Develop subassembly test procedures as needed
Construct, calibrate, adjust, test, and maintain equipment we use to support RF testing/tuning
Identify any discrepancies within testing
Collaborate with all functional groups on various projects
Maintain accurate records, fill out logs accurately, and explain defects found-clearly and concisely
Test the product according to the design engineer instructions, test plans, customer specifications, internal specifications & procedures
